The Swiss legal frame for association accounting

A small business does not mean small obligations: from the first salary or the first VAT return, mistakes get expensive — in Holziken as anywhere.

Art. 957a CO requires complete, truthful and systematic recording of transactions, each entry backed by a supporting document. For association accounting, that means in practice: no movement without a receipt, and an audit trail that can be reconstructed at any time — including during a VAT or AHV inspection.

A well-structured SME chart of accounts

A good chart of accounts tells the story of the business: classes 1 and 2 describe what it owns and owes, class 3 what it sells, classes 4 to 6 what it consumes. Private accounts (sole proprietorships) and shareholder current accounts (Sàrl/SA) must stay spotless: they are the first thing examined in a tax audit.

For association accounting, a few well-chosen analytical accounts (by activity, by site) beat a forest of sub-accounts nobody ever reads.

When is entry in the commercial register mandatory?

A Sàrl and an SA only come into existence with their registration. A sole proprietorship must register from CHF 100,000 of annual revenue; below that, registration stays voluntary but adds credibility and protects the business name. Registration goes through the canton's commercial register office — for Holziken too.

When must a business register for VAT?

As soon as its worldwide annual turnover reaches CHF 100,000 (CHF 250,000 for non-profit sports or cultural associations). Below that, voluntary registration remains possible and often makes sense to reclaim input VAT on investments. The threshold is federal: it applies in Holziken as everywhere in Switzerland.

What are the legal obligations for association accounting in Switzerland?

The foundation is the Code of Obligations: proper bookkeeping (art. 957a CO), annual accounts (balance sheet, income statement, notes) and 10-year retention of books and records (art. 958f CO). VAT applies from CHF 100,000 of turnover, and social insurance settlements from the first employee. Nothing is different in Holziken: federal law applies.
